Understanding Chipboard Screws The 40mm Dimension


When it comes to woodworking and construction projects, the choice of screws can significantly impact the overall strength and durability of the assembly. One of the unsung heroes in the fastener world is the chipboard screw, especially the 40mm variant. Chipboard screws are specifically designed for use with particle board or chipboard, offering a specialized solution for a wide range of applications, from assembling furniture to constructing cabinetry.


What are Chipboard Screws?


Chipboard screws are designed to provide superior holding power in chipboard and similar materials. These screws usually feature a coarse thread that enables them to bite into the rough surface of the particle board, creating a strong grip. Unlike standard wood screws, chipboard screws typically have a self-tapping feature that allows them to be driven directly into the material without the need for a pilot hole, making them ideal for quick assembly.

Advantages of Using Chipboard Screws


1. Improved Grip The coarse threads are specifically intended for use in chipboard, enhancing the screw's grip and reducing the likelihood of strip-out, which is common with finer-thread screws in softer materials.


2. Self-Tapping Design The self-tapping tip helps to reduce splitting and cracking in the chipboard, allowing for cleaner and faster assembly.


3. Versatile Usage Beyond furniture assembly, chipboard screws can also be utilized in various applications, including construction projects where particle board or related materials are employed.

4. Durability Chipboard screws are typically made from steel and may be coated to resist rust and corrosion, ensuring a longer lifespan even in humid environments.


5. Ease of Use Their self-drilling features make chipboard screws user-friendly, even for those who may not have extensive woodworking experience.


Installation Tips for Optimal Performance


To achieve the best results when using 40mm chipboard screws, consider the following tips


- Use the Right Driver A power drill or a screwdriver with adequate torque is essential. This will help drive the screws efficiently without stripping them. - Pre-drilling (Optional) While chipboard screws generally do not require pilot holes, pre-drilling can still be useful if you’re joining thicker materials or if you notice excessive splitting in the board.


- Apply Even Pressure When driving the screws in, make sure to apply even and consistent pressure to ensure they seat properly without damaging the chipboard.


- Consider Placement Ensure the screws are placed strategically for maximum hold—at corners and intersections where they're needed most.
